La Clinique des femmes de l’Outaouais is a non profit feminist organization founded in 1981. It offers health services in family planning, in particular, the voluntary termination of pregnancy and contraception.
La Clinique des femmes de l’Outaouais has a feminist philosophy based on freedom of choice and participates in the defense of this right for all women. This philosophy is characterized by the enhancement of women’s potential, freedom to control their own bodies, empowerment, equality and social justice. The clinic welcomes a diversity of women, expressed by differences in age, creed, origin, social class, education, health condition, sexual orientation and identity or any other forms.
The clinic and its members refuse all forms of discrimination and oppression whether they come from a religious influence, violence against women or sexual assault, and all social, racial and economic inequalities that persist within our society.
The clinic collaborates with other organizations to end taboos and myths surrounding abortion and freedom of choice. All our services are confidential, safe and welcoming. We favour a comprehensive approach to women’s health. Thus, their needs and their welfare is not only central to our intervention, but their choices and preferences are respected.
